Program Used: Adobe Premiere 6.5

I'm trying to make all my future AMVs in .AVI or .MPG format(hurray) so I've been using Adobe a lot more. Currently I'm finishing up a test-project using Naruto RAWs and now I'm trying to work on getting the best quality when exporting the clips to a movie.

Ok my question is: What, in your opinion(s) is the best compressor to use when compiling videos on Adobe.

Currently the default I've been using is Cinepack Codec by Radius which worked fine in the past but lately has a bunch of ugly pixel lines in it.

Anything lossless, like HuffYUV or Lagarith or (*shudder*) uncompressed.
